Seven IPL teams – Mumbai Indians, Delhi Capitals, Royal Challengers Bangalore, Sunrisers Hyderabad, Kolkata Knight Riders, Rajasthan Royals and Punjab Kings – are known to have submitted on Monday are technical applications (meeting the eligibility criteria).

The newest IPL teams, Gujarat Titans and Lucknow Super Giants, who entered the league in 2021 by paying big money, have not wanted much on their plate for now and have left. Surprisingly, Chennai Super Kings, who also have a team in the ongoing T20 league in South Africa, did not make a technical bid.

Companies outside the IPL mix that have shown interest include Adani Group, Torrent Pharma and Capri Global. Everyone almost missed the bus in the latest IPL team expansion.

The economics involved in the WIPL are very different as the media rights over five years are 951 crores, which is 2 percent of the value of the men’s IPL rights. However, the numbers were ground-breaking for women’s cricket (₹7.09 crore per match) and stakeholders are excited to see how this value can help their league succeed in the long run.

The media rights amount confirms that the revenue of the franchises is around 300 crores over 10 years. This will help offset the licensing costs payable to the BCCI. The higher they got, the longer it would take for them to break even. If many of those who showed early interest also submit a financial bid, there may be a few high bidders.

The BCCI has clarified in the tender documents that they are not obliged to award the team ownership to the highest bidder and will look at the proposal for the growth of women’s cricket that the bidders come up with. For those outside the IPL ecosystem, their bids may be higher.

“We have kept it open for anyone who meets the eligibility criteria to apply. But we will be very happy if the existing franchisees will follow our thinking to make the league successful,” IPL chairman Arun Dhumal said last week.

Given the long-term potential of the league, the presence of corporate social responsibility and the opportunity for existing IPL teams to expand their cricket calendar with another competition involving Indian cricketers, anything between Rs 2,500-3,500 for five teams would not surprise anyone. .

Prospective team owners have been given the opportunity to make ten cities – Ahmedabad, Kolkata, Chennai, Bangalore, Delhi, Dharamsala, Guwahati, Indore, Lucknow and Mumbai – their home.

But this will still be nothing more than a brand-building exercise, with the BCCI looking to start the league by concentrating the matches in one or two cities. The opening edition is scheduled to be played in Mumbai.

More than 30 conglomerates from information technology (IT), FMCG and several other sectors, including the cement industry, have accepted tenders (ITT) to buy a franchise in the women’s IPL, apart from the 10 teams in the men’s competition.

Haldiram Group, APL Apollo, Shriram Group, Nilgiri Group and AW Katkuri Group are some of the names that have picked up ITT, according to the report.

Chettinad Cement and JK Cement have also shown interest in buying a franchise in the women’s T20 league, drawing inspiration from India Cements (owners of Chennai Super Kings). Several groups in other T20 leagues, Capri Global (Sharjah Warriors in ILT20) and Adani Group (Gulf Giants in ILT20) have also bought ITT.

Interestingly, the co-owners of Delhi Capitals, JSW and GMR groups have gone it alone and submitted their bids separately, the report said. This has also happened before when JSW bought a team in SA20 (Pretoria Capitals) and GMR went on to buy a team in ILT20 (Dubai Capitals), albeit with the same branding.

The Women’s IPL (WIPL) got a mini-bonanza on Monday as it got ready for the March kick off. The Indian Cricket Board has announced Viacom 18 as the broadcast partner, committing ₹951 crore for 134 matches at ₹7.09 crore per match for the first five years (2023-27).

“This is huge for women’s cricket,” BCCI secretary Jay Shah tweeted. “Today’s bid for media rights to the women’s IPL marks another historic mandate. It is a big and decisive step for the empowerment of women’s cricket in India, which will ensure the participation of women of all ages. A new dawn indeed.”

Comparisons cannot be drawn with the IPL, whose media rights for five years (2023-27) were sold for Rs 48,390 crore last year. The magnificent men’s league is entering its 16th edition, while India’s women cricketers are yet to become world leaders and few of them are household names.

The impact of these numbers can still be far-reaching. “Words really cannot describe what this means to a young girl in India, to women’s cricket in India, to the women’s game and to sports in general. So happy to see this. This will change the landscape forever,” tweeted Lisa Stalekar, former Australian player now president of international cricket body FICA.

While Cricket Australia introduced the Women’s Big Bash League in 2015–16 and The Hundred has seen two seasons in England, media rights for both tournaments are bundled with the men’s tournament.

“We had no expectations as we felt the market was the best place to find value,” IPL chairman Arun Dhumal said. “I’m happy that the number we have is more than in any other league.”

While the WIPL has become the most rated league after the IPL, new entrants are displacing the franchise scheme, the ILT20 in the UAE and the SA20 in South Africa.

That doesn’t mean there was a crazy bid for WIPL rights. Disney Star was the only bidder besides Viacom 18. It was a conservative digital-only bid (98 crore). Sony-Zee showed no interest.

Market experts say Viacom 18’s bid shows it wants to make more inroads into the cricket market after acquiring its IPL (digital) and Cricket South Africa rights.
